The Just Like Paradise Songfacts says: David Lee Roth went out on the edge for rock climbing footage used in the video and on the Skyscraper cover art, showing Roth clinging like a bug to the solid rock face of a mountain. That mountain is the famous Half Dome of Yosemite, an icon of California embedded on the state quarter and the driver's license. The really was Roth up there, although we didn't see the "bouts of shakes and deep breaths" that a member of the crew later described. David Lee Roth (born October 10, 1954 in Bloomington, Indiana) is an American singer-songwriter, rock climber, adventurer, actor, author, and former radio personality, being best known for his work with the hard rock band Van Halen and for his fast-talking, larger-than-life persona. Though earning critical and commercial success, Roth left Van Halen due to creative differences in 1985, being replaced by Sammy Hagar (of Montrose and HSAS), and Roth went solo.
